Strength training builds muscle and bigger muscles raise your BMR, which means you burn more calories at rest, which means that in the very long run strength training contributes marginally to the weight loss. But in the immediate sense weight lifting does not consume enough calories to shed weight. 2. read more

Perspiration Weight Loss. People differ in how much they sweat, but on average, people lose 1 to 1.5 pounds of water by sweating each day. If you live in a hotter climate, exercise more or have a less efficient thermoregulatory thermostat, you might lose more weight through perspiration. read more
